I'm wondering if it matters which way oil flows through the cooler. My issue is my oil lines(steel braded hoses) cross each other so hard that they will chafe. Also the long (from) line from the engine is too close to the back of the left mag. If I uncross the hoses to correct the problems and reconnect, the long hose will have to be remade/replaced with one 2" longer. If it doesn't matter which way the hoses connect to the cooler (I can't imagine why it would), I could simply switch hose connections at the cooler and be done with it.

Ideally, the oil enters the cooler at the bottom so any air is pushed out the top of the cooler and you get full benefit of the cooling capacity of whatever oil cooler you install.
